Key Numbers to Carry Into March in Auburn, MA

The median home value holds steady at $484,580, up 6.6 percent from last year, while the median list price remains $569,000 and median closed price is $436,625. Inventory is still tight at 0.74 months and homes are lasting just 35 days before closing. Why does this matter? Knowing how affordable homes in Auburn, MA this February 2026 moved can inform smarter choices as March opportunities appear.

  • Sold-to-list ratio closes out at 101.9 percent

  • Closed volume for the quarter: nearly $4.79 million
  • Households show a strong 66 percent ownership rate
